The revamped reset flow in Fernwick Identity moves token generation off the main auth workers and onto a dedicated pool. Plugin authors should assume reset throughput is now bounded by the token pool size rather than SMTP dispatch. We sized the pool for roughly triple our observed peak, with headroom for the Solvane marketing pushes that historically spike resets. If your plugin hooks the pre-reset event, keep handlers under the stated budget or they will be shed. Current planning constants are as follows.

limits module of fajog-tawig:
RATE_LIMITS = {
    "druwyn": 2,
    "quenael": 10,
    "wenix": 2,
    "druael": 2,
}

Hey Priya — handing off the build agent clock skew issue on the Corvana fleet. Agents in the Dellmouth rack drift ~40s, which breaks signed artifact timestamps. I've pinned them to the internal NTP pool for now. To unlock the skew-audit vault, use the recovery passphrase below.

recovery phrase for fajep-yaweg: gilath-sorox-wenius-rusdor-keliel-zorius

Subject: Weather-alert fan-out cut-over — done

Hi all — quick summary for the sync. We cut the Stormrelay fan-out over to the new queue-based pipeline on Tuesday night. Latency from alert ingest to push dropped noticeably, and the old polling workers are now drained and idle (we'll decommission them next week). One hiccup: a brief duplicate-delivery burst during the switch, mitigated by the dedupe window. The pipeline is now running with the configuration values below.

settings of tajep-tafog:
CASDOR_LOG_LEVEL=info
CASDOR_METRICS_HOST=metrics.casdor.nelvrosys.internal
CASDOR_POOL_SIZE=16

## Runbook: Clock skew on Forgeline build agents

Clock skew greater than two seconds between Forgeline agents causes artifact signatures to be rejected and can silently reorder build timestamps in the release manifest. Before cutting a release, verify that all agents report drift within tolerance against the coordinator. If any agent exceeds the threshold, quarantine it, force a time resync, and re-verify before re-admitting it to the pool. The skew monitor runs with the following configuration values.

config for kawig-tawip:
quenwyn:
  pin: 7394
  metrics_host: metrics.quenwyn.qorvelsys.internal
  tenant: sorys
  seal: seal_474848d1